Board of Examiners
Mandate
The Board of Examiners (BoE) is established by agreement between the Urban Municipal Administrators Association of Saskatchewan (UMAAS) and the Saskatchewan Urban Municipalities Association (SUMA) to administer the municipal administrator certification program. The Board is responsible for establishing certification criteria, reviewing applications, and issuing, suspending, or cancelling certificates in accordance with the Board of Examiners Agreement and applicable policies.
